Identifying Essential Musical Genres
There is an incredible world of music to explore, with a plethora of genres that act as an effective tool for instructing kids. Recognizing these essential music genres can shape your child's learning process and cognitive growth. Each genre, with its individual characteristics, provides a distinct path for learning and understanding. Let's take folk music for instance. It's rich in storytelling and cultural heritage, providing kids a way to learn about various cultures. Additionally, there is classical music, famous for its intricate structures and patterns, boosting a child's analytical abilities. Or consider jazz, with its spontaneous nature, encouraging creativity. Comprehending these genre characteristics is key to designing an beneficial educational music playlist for kids.

Classical Music for Kids: The Benefits and Top Picks
Exposing your children to classical music might not be the first thing you consider when investigating educational options, but it needs to be. The intricate structures and harmonies of works by classical composers can boost cognitive growth, developing memory, spatial reasoning, and attention span. Developing music appreciation during childhood can also contribute to enhanced creativity and emotional intelligence.
Top musical choices for young listeners include "Eine kleine Nachtmusik" by Mozart, "Fur Elise" by Beethoven, and "The Nutcracker Suite" by Tchaikovsky. These pieces are accessible and wonderfully beautiful, offering a perfect introduction to classical music. So, don't delay - immerse your kids in the uplifting sounds of classical music. It's a present that will bring lasting benefits.

Math Learning Melodies
If you're looking for a fun way to help your child learn basic concepts, look no further than counting songs. These songs, carefully designed with kids in mind, are filled with memorable numerical beats, turning learning into fun. Counting tunes include basic math in their verses, helping children to grasp numbers and basic arithmetic. They improve mental growth by involving kids in interactive learning while improving their listening abilities. The repetitive nature of these songs solidifies number recognition, counting proficiency, and number ordering. Thus, never underestimate the effectiveness of a engaging melody. Start using counting tunes into your child's daily routine and witness as they cultivate a passion for numerical learning.

Tunes for Toddlers: Playlists to Enhance Early Childhood Development
While many parents instinctively sing lullabies to soothe their young ones, there's more to music than just calming effects. Toddler tunes also play an essential role in early childhood development. They help kids hit important musical milestones, such as rhythm recognition and melody mimicry. As you introduce your child to the world of music, it's imperative to select songs that boost cognitive growth. Seek out playful, engaging tracks that invite interaction. Nursery rhymes, repetitive songs, and even tunes with simple dance moves can be beneficial. Remember, it's not just about entertainment. You're fostering a love for music while enhancing your toddler's development. So, sing along, tap your foot, and watch your little one's progress through the power of toddler tunes.

Educational Music Activities: Creating Interactive Fun
Taking the power of music even further by making it a key element in your child's learning journey? Interactive musical activities transform education into an entertaining experience. Integrate musical games into their daily routine. You can experiment with 'Name that Tune' or 'Dance and Stop', which not only entertains them but also enhances their memory and listening skills. Musical timing games are an excellent way to enhance cognitive growth. Utilize household items for making music and create simple rhythmic patterns. Encourage them to copy these patterns, enhancing their motor skills and sense of timing. It's not just about enjoying music, it's about connecting with it. Keep in mind, when learning is entertaining, it's more impactful.
How to Make Your Own Music Learning Library for Young Learners
Ever get more info thought about making a custom educational playlist for kids? It's easier than you'd imagine. Start by thinking about your playlist organization. This is the general progression of your playlist, moving from lively songs to calm, peaceful tunes. Following that, consider song picks. Select songs that are not just entertaining, but also instructive. These could contain lessons about counting, the alphabet, or even behavioral lessons. Go for a blend of both traditional favorites and new additions to maintain variety. Take into account your child's interests, too. If they enjoy animals, incorporate songs about wildlife. Lastly, regularly refresh the playlist to hold their attention. With careful planning and imagination, you'll create an educational playlist your kids will love.
